Spurs v Watford Facts

Number of games since a win = 2 (30.01.2019)
Number of games since a defeat = (02.09.2018)
Number of games since a draw = 0 (18.01.2020)
       
Number of games since a home win = 1 (30.01.2019)
Number of games since a home defeat = 9 (04.10.1994)
Number of games since a home draw = 0 (19.10.2019)
       
Number of games since an away win = 3 (01.01.2017)
Number of games since an away defeat = 1 (02.09.2018)
Number of games since an away draw = 0 (18.01.2020)
       
Number of games since a goal-less draw = 0 (18.01.2020)
Number of games since a scoring draw = 1 (19.10.2019)
       


 

Biggest home win =  7 - 0 on 19.01.1901
                                    8 - 1 on 26.10.1901
Biggest away win =   6 - 3 on 21.09.1994 and 
                                     3 - 0
on 08.02.1902 and 27.02.1943
Biggest home defeat = 1 - 5 on 11.05.1985
Biggest away defeat = 1 - 6 on 30.12.1939
Highest aggregate of goals in a match = 10  -  8-2 on 11.11.1939

Biggest home crowd = 47,634 on 06.11.1922
Smallest home crowd = 3,000 on 30.10.1915
Biggest away crowd = 27,373 on 19.03.1983
Smallest away crowd = 2,000 on 15.01.1916, 07.10.1916 and 30.12.1939
Biggest crowd on a neutral venue = 46,151 on 11.04.1987 -  FA Cup SF at Villa Park

Longest sequence without scoring =   1 game (6.01.1906, 13.04.1907, 06.04.1942, 06.11.1982, 14.12.1985, 09.05.1987 and 28.10.2006)
Longest sequence without conceding =   5 games (30.10.1915 to 28.01.1922)

Longest sequence without a loss =    20 games (19.01.1901 to 11.11.1939 = 15 wins + 5 draws)
Longest sequence without a win =   2 games (09.05.1987 to 29.08.1987 = 1 defeat + 1 draw)

Most goals in a game for Spurs against Watford = 3 - Alex "Sandy" Brown on 26.10.1901
                                                                                            Les Medley on 11.11.1939
                                                                                            Les Bennett on 11.11.1939
                                                                                            George Ludford on 30.08.1941
                                                                                            Ron Burgess on 20.11.1943
                                                                                            Jurgen Klinsmann on 21.09.1994
